Select element display/hide

Tags:    javascript html

Hej, jeg ved godt jeg har stillet det her spørgsmål før, men jeg har virkelig brug for hjælp til det. Jeg vil godt have en select tabel være usynlig først, men når man så vælger noget på en anden select tabel, så skal den blive synlig.

Det her er hvad jeg har prøvet indtil videre:

Fold kodeboks ind/udKode 


Jeg ved godt, at der er noget der ikke stemmer med display, men det er sådan her det ser ud nu, men det virker ikke bare ved at jeg ændre display funktionerne.

Ved ikke om i kan hjælpe, men jeg vil blive glad, hvis i nu kan :)



Indlæg senest redigeret d. 17.03.2011 14:53 af Bruger #14776
6 svar postet i denne tråd vises herunder
2 indlæg har modtaget i alt 7 karma
Sorter efter stemmer Sorter efter dato
Du er på rette spor, men har bare gjort det lidt omvendt.

Den select, der starter som usynlig skal se sådan ud (udfyld selv options-værdierne):

Fold kodeboks ind/udKode 


Og den synlige skal se sådan ud:
Fold kodeboks ind/udKode 




Således:

Fold kodeboks ind/udKode 




Indlæg senest redigeret d. 18.03.2011 12:13 af Bruger #69
Ja, jeg har fået det til at virke nu tak :).

Kan jeg få den til at blive usynlig igen, hvis jeg bagefter vælger noget andet?

Jeg har ændret onchange til onclick, da onchange ikke virkede som jeg ville have at den skulle.



Det kan du godt. Men du må nok hellere forklare præcist, hvad det er, du vil opnå. Jeg vil dog ikke anbefale at bruge onclick, da det er en trigger, som vil blive udløst, så snart der bliver klikke på den første select - uanset, om brugeren vælger noget eller ej.



Jeg vil godt have at, hvis man vælger noget på en menu, så kommer der en ny menu frem, så man vil kunne forklare lidt mere præcist, hvorfor det er man kontakter mig.

F.eks. man klikker på et valg i den første menu, som kunne hedde Rapportéring af fejl. Så vil der komme en ny menu frem, hvor man vil kunne vælge, hvor man nu har fundet fejlen henne.

Her ville jeg nu godt have at, hvis man nu vælger ikke, at ville Rapportere en fejl, men i stedet vælge andet, så skulle menuen gerne forsvinde, så man ikke bliver forvirret af den.

Det er mest det, som jeg gerne vil opnå med denne funtion.



Fedt, det virker helt præcis som jeg ville have det :D.

Tak skal du have :).



t